General Notes: Husband - Hon. Joseph Cunningham


He purchased his residence, known as Locust Ridge Home, and settled on it in 1848. In 1855 he was elected a Justice of the Peace; and re-elected to the same office in 1860. In 1861 he was elected to the position of Associate Judge.

In the possession of Hon. Joseph Cunningham were a number of old volumes, deserving mention from their antiquity. Among them was a volume printed by E. Griffin, in 1644, at London, England. The author was "Samuel Rutherford," Professor of Divinity at St. Andrews. The title of the work is "The Due Right of Presbyteries; or, a Peaceable Plea for the Government of the Church of Scotland." Another is a Gaelic Bible, printed in Edinburgh, Scotland, in 1807. There was also a "Schoolmaster's Assistant," printed in Meath street,. Dublin, Ireland, in 1762, by Isaac Jackson, edited by Thomas Dilworth, a schoolmaster; a work on surveying, by Henry Wilson, printed in London, in 1731; and a number of ancient volumes, all well preserved. The binding on all of them was of leather. The books were the property of Donald McGregor, who brought them to America with him when he settled, about 1808 or 1809. McGregor located on the south side of Conoquenessing creek, on the farm later owned by P. M. Cunningham.
